The HEIC files being displayed by default is a bit tricky because HEIC is a proprietary file format and isn't supported because to render it requires a license. Essentially, Apple would need to be the ones to change that and in all honesty, it may not happen anytime soon. You can however restrict file types so students have to convert it to jpg, jpeg, png, etc. I know this isn't ideal but unfortunately it is the restrictions that Canvas has to work within.
